Ethereum gas fee spikes during NFT drops affecting casino withdrawal timing and costs

Noticed something interesting during the recent Pudgy Penguins mint - ETH gas fees spiked to 180+ gwei and my Ignition withdrawal that normally processes in 2-3 hours took over 12 hours. Same thing happened during the Azuki drop last month.

Most crypto casinos seem to batch ETH withdrawals and wait for gas to drop below certain thresholds. Wild Casino actually paused ETH withdrawals completely during the peak congestion. Anyone else tracking how different casinos handle these network spikes? Some are eating the extra gas costs while others just delay everything.

    Cafe Casino actually sent me an email during the last major gas spike explaining the delay. They said they batch withdrawals and only process when gas drops below 50 gwei to keep costs reasonable. I appreciated the transparency instead of just wondering why my withdrawal was stuck. Most casinos should adopt this communication approach.

    I've been tracking this across multiple casinos. Voltage and Shazam seem to have the most aggressive batching - they'll wait up to 24 hours for gas to drop. Lucky Creek processes regardless of gas prices but passes the full cost to players. There's definitely no standard approach across the industry.

    Pro tip: Check gas trackers before requesting ETH withdrawals. If there's a major NFT mint or DeFi event happening, consider waiting or switching to a different crypto.

    Good point about checking gas trackers first. I use ETH Gas Station and Blocknative before making withdrawal requests now. Also noticed that Layer 2 options like Polygon are becoming more attractive during these congestion periods - instant and cheap regardless of mainnet activity.
